    // positiveAtoi returns an int64 that must be >= 0.
    func (p *Parser) positiveAtoi(str string) int64 {
    	value, err := strconv.ParseInt(str, 0, 64)
    	if err != nil {
    		p.errorf("%s", err)
    	}
    	if value < 0 {
    		p.errorf("%s overflows int64", str)
    	}
    	return value
    }

    // uint8 is the set of all unsigned 8-bit integers.
    // Range: 0 through 255.
    type uint8 uint8
    
    // uint16 is the set of all unsigned 16-bit integers.
    // Range: 0 through 65535.
    type uint16 uint16
    
    // uint32 is the set of all unsigned 32-bit integers.
    // Range: 0 through 4294967295.
    type uint32 uint32
